WordPress Redis 快取:設定逐步教學

已發表: 2023-10-26

想要為您的網站設定 WordPress Redis 快取嗎?

Redis 是一種快取技術,可用於進一步提高網站效能。 它不是 WordPress 專用軟體,但它與 WordPress 完美配合。 此外,您不需要依賴您的網站主機來為您安裝它(儘管如果您的主機確實提供預先安裝的 Redis 會更簡單)。

在本文中,我們將詳細討論 Redis 是什麼及其運作方式。 然後我們將介紹如何設定和配置 WordPress Redis 快取。

讓我們開始吧!

透過本教學了解如何在 #WordPress 中設定 #Redis #cache ‍
點擊發推文

為什麼要使用 WordPress Redis 快取

關於 Redis,您需要了解的主要一點是它是一個「記憶體中」快取系統。 通常,快取使用磁碟來儲存資訊。 這表示當您查詢時,伺服器需要查找硬碟(或 SSD)上的資訊。

您可能知道,記憶體比其他形式的儲存要快得多。 它並不是為了儲存大量資料而設計的,而只是為了儲存您目前可能需要的資料。 Redis 使您能夠使用系統記憶體作為快取。 這意味著訪客可以獲得更快的載入時間,因為伺服器可以查詢記憶體而不是磁碟。

Redis也可以使用磁碟進行緩存,但是它主要依賴系統的記憶體。 使用 Redis 的另一個好處是它是「分散式」的。 這意味著多個伺服器可以共用一個 Redis 實例,如果您使用雲端託管,這是理想的選擇。

如果所有這些看起來太技術性,您需要知道的是 Redis 可以讓您的 WordPress 網站加載速度更快。 但是,要進行設置,您需要熟悉伺服器層級的工作。

如何三步驟安裝Redis WordPress緩存

需要注意的是,如果要安裝 Redis,則需要存取伺服器。 這意味著能夠設定新軟體並更改其配置,這通常是使用終端進行的。

如果您使用共享託管,您將無法存取伺服器或無法變更其配置。 除了存取伺服器之外,您還需要使用 WP-CLI 來設定我們將與 Redis 一起使用的插件。

如果您沒有此訪問權限,我們建議您聯絡主機的支援人員,詢問他們是否可以選擇為您安裝 Redis。

  • 步驟1:安裝Redis伺服器
  • 第 2 步:安裝 Redis PHP 擴充功能
  • 第 3 步:設定和設定 Redis 物件快取 WordPress 插件

步驟1:安裝Redis伺服器️

大多數 Web 伺服器使用基於 Linux 的作業系統 (OS)。 這意味著您可以使用終端安裝軟體,這就是我們對 Redis 伺服器所做的事情。 首先,打開終端機並輸入以下命令:

sudo apt-get update

這將更新軟體包索引,並且始終建議在 Linux 發行版上安裝新軟體包之前執行此操作。 更新完成後,輸入以下命令:

sudo apt-get install redis-server

還有其他方法來安裝軟體包,具體取決於您使用的 Linux 發行版。 然而,在大多數情況下,命令列提供了最簡單、最直接的選項。

下載軟體包後,它將自動安裝。 若要測試 Redis 伺服器是否正常執行,您將使用下列命令對其進行 ping 操作:

redis-cli ping

如果軟體正在運行,它將返回訊息「PONG」。 這意味著您可以繼續配置它。

步驟2:安裝Redis PHP擴充️

如果您要使用 WordPress Redis 緩存,那麼直接從 WordPress 配置該軟體是有意義的。 這種方法意味著您不需要使用命令列手動配置 Redis,這可能是一個耗時的過程。

為了實現這一點,您需要一種讓 WordPress 與 Redis 溝通的方法。 這就是 phpredis 擴充的用武之地。

phpredis 擴充功能可讓您設定 WordPress 可用於與 Redis 通訊的 API。 它是使您能夠將 CMS 連接到 Redis 伺服器的橋樑。

與 Redis Serve 一樣,您可以使用終端機並輸入以下命令來安裝 phpredis:

sudo apt-get install php-redis

安裝完成後,就可以轉移到 WordPress 了。 現在我們要討論如何將 CMS 與 Redis 介接。

步驟 3:設定和設定 Redis 物件快取 WordPress 外掛️

Redis 物件緩存 Redis 物件緩存

作者:蒂爾克魯斯

目前版本: 2.4.4

最後更新時間: 2023 年 8 月 11 日

redis-cache.2.4.4.zip

90%收視率100,000+安裝WP 3.3+需要

Redis 物件快取是一個 WordPress 插件,它與 phpredis API 連接以幫助配置您的 WordPress 網站以使用 Redis 伺服器。 如果這聽起來令人困惑,請記住該插件基本上是即插即用的。 這意味著一旦您啟動它,它就會自動配置 WordPress 以使用 Redis 快取您的網站。

啟動外掛後,前往「設定」“Redis” 。 在這裡您將看到插件是否可以連接到 Redis 伺服器的概述:

WordPress Redis 快取概述。

如果外掛程式顯示狀態為Connected ,這表示它將開始使用 Redis 來快取您的網站。 使用此外掛程式(以及大多數其他 WordPress Redis 快取工具)的缺點是它們不提供儀表板中的設定選項。

Redis 物件快取要求您使用 WP-CLI 變更其配置。 一旦插件激活,您應該會立即看到效能的改善。 但是,如果您想設定 Redis,則需要使用 WP-CLI 來變更軟體的設定。

轉到頂部

立即嘗試 WordPress Redis 快取

Redis 是一個令人驚嘆的工具,可以提高網站的效能。 如果您有權存取伺服器,則可以安裝 Redis 並將其配置為相對簡單地與 WordPress 配合使用。 為此,您需要能夠使用終端和 WP-CLI。

透過本教學了解如何在 #WordPress 中設定 #Redis #cache ‍
點擊發推文

如果您有權存取伺服器和 WP-CLI,則使用 WordPress Redis 快取需要執行以下操作:

  1. ️ 安裝 Redis 伺服器。
  2. ️ 安裝 Redis PHP 擴充功能。
  3. ️ 設定和配置 Redis 物件快取。

如果您不想自行安裝和設定 Redis,您也可以使用託管 WordPress 託管提供者來為您處理事情。

您對如何設定和配置 WordPress Redis 快取有任何疑問嗎? 讓我們在下面的評論部分討論它們吧!

免費指導

加速的 4 個基本步驟
您的 WordPress 網站

請按照我們的 4 部分迷你係列中的簡單步驟進行操作
並將載入時間減少 50-80%。

免費進入